Fortnite: Battle Royale – The Cube Queen Quests Guide

After many weeks, the secret outfit for Chapter 2, Season 8, The Cube Queen, is now available, and with her arrival comes new challenges and quests to tackle. Like the Deadpool, Aquaman, Wolverine, Predator, Neymar Jr. and Superman outfits from seasons before, these quests and challenges earn us exclusive cosmetics and rewards. In this guide, we go over all the Cube Queen challenges in Fortnite: Battle Royale.

The Cube Queen Quests (Page 1)

Survive Storm Circles While Carrying A Sideways Weapon (5)

This quest will earn you the Cube Queen outfit!

Eliminate A Player With The Sideways Minigun (1)

The Sideways Minigun can be found in Sideways anomalies and eliminating a player will reward you with the Last Cube Standing emoticon.

Shakedown Opponents (2)

This quest will earn you the Queen’s Court loading screen.

Use A Shadow Stone Or Flopper To Phase For 3 Seconds Near A Player (3)

This quest will earn you the Cubic Vortex back bling.

Complete All Of The Cube Queen Quests On Page 1 (4)

Completing the first 4 quests will give you the Obliterator edit style for the Cube Queen and her back bling!

The Cube Queen Quests (Page 2)

Deal Damage To Players With The Sideways Scythe (150)

The Sideways Scythe can be found inside Sideways anomalies. Completing the quest will give you the Reality Render harvesting tool.

Complete A Bounty From A Bounty Board (1)

Bounty Boards are marked on the mini-map. This quest will give you the Regal Visage spray.

Get Player Headshots With The Sideways Rifle (1)

Aim for the head! This quest will give you the Queen’s Anthem music pack.

Glide In The Smoke Stacks At Steamy Stacks (1)

This quest will give you the Queen’s Procession glider.

Complete All Of The Cube Queen Quests On Page 2 (4)

Completing the next 4 quests will give you the Islandbane edit style for the Cube Queen and her other cosmetics!

Fortnite: Battle Royale – Shortnitemares Showings And Guide

Short Nite 1 and the sequel Short Nite 2 were hugely successful and featured a bunch of underrated yet talented animators, and it seems like Epic is coming back with Shortnitemares, themed around spooky short films. Same song and dance as the two previous events: Animated shorts released in the aesthetic of a film festival. This event will take place in a player-built theater made in Creative mode, which shorts running from October 28 to November 1.

While we don’t have a full list of all 7 shorts yet, we have some important details:

  1. The new Kernel Poppy outfit, Slurpy Slush’em back bling and Butter Buddy emote will be available in the Item Shop the day before Shortnitemares, on October 27.
  2. You can watch the shorts in any language you like, complete with subtitles.
  3. Recording is not allowed, just like in a real film festival. We don’t know the consequence of uploading footage onto YouTube or Vimeo, but it will most likely end in a fine of some sort, which is why we won’t upload anything related to the event.
  4. Watch the shorts for 30 minutes and you will receive the Spray Matter spray.

Fortnite: Battle Royale – Monster Hunter Questline Guide

Chapter 2, Season 8 of Fortnite introduced questlines into Battle Royale, a feature that was in Save The World ever since its release. One of the questlines, Monster Hunter, has Ariana Grande talk about and study the Sideways monsters. Why Ariana Grande is a space marine we will never know, but nonetheless, here are all the Monster Hunter quests!

The Quests

Collect A Record And Place In A Turntable (1)

Accept Dialogue: Wanna hunt some nasty monsters? Let’s set the tone!

Guide: Records can be placed in the Believer Beach, Retail Row or Apres Ski turntables.

Complete Dialogue: Nice distraction tactic. I love this song.

Reward: 12,000 XP and 20 Bars

Study The Caretaker’s Footprints (2)

Accept Dialogue: Track the big guy’s positions with his footprints. I want a closer look.

Guide: Caretaker footprints are large, purple and glowing, and can be found in every POI except for Coral Castle, Weeping Woods, Sludgy Swamp and Steamy Stacks.

Complete Dialogue: It looks like he’s just wandering and waiting. But for what?

Reward: 14,000 XP and 25 Bars

Collect Symbols From Eliminated Cube Monsters (5)

Accept Dialogue: A dead end. Take some monsters off the table and see what we can find.

Guide: The symbols are rather large and take a few seconds to collect. Cube monsters are most commonly found inside Sideways anomalies.

Complete Dialogue: The Cube Queen’s using a hidden command symbol. We have to unlock it.

Reward: 16,000 XP and 30 Bars

Reveal The Command Signal (3)

Accept Dialogue: Perform actions to reveal the symbol. We’ve gotta uncover the Cube Queen’s motive.

Guide: The Cube Queen’s command signals can be found at Believer Beach, Weeping Woods, Corny Crops, Retail Row and Misty Meadows.

Complete Dialogue: According to this, once the Cube Queen gives the command, things will get bad.

Reward: 18,000 XP and 40 Bars

Launch Signal Flares (3)

Accept Dialogue: I’ve got a good POV on these monsters. Signal more hunters here!

Guide: 4 signal flares can be found around the map: One by the alien crash site near Holly Hedges, one on the mountain north of Misty Meadows (Where Rick Sanchez was last season), one by Craggy Cliffs and one by the alien crash site near Dirty Docks.

Complete Dialogue: Find someone with knowledge of the Cube Queen. There must be a way to stop her!

Reward: 20,000 XP and 70 Bars

Fortnite: Battle Royale – Ghostbusters Afterlife Questline Guide

Chapter 2, Season 8 of Fortnite introduced questlines into Battle Royale, a feature that was in Save The World ever since its release. One of the questlines, Ghostbusters: Afterlife, is themed around the Ghostbusters and the upcoming film Ghostbusters: Afterlife, and requires us to complete some ghost-themed quests. These quests can also help you unlock the “No Ghost” back bling.

The Quests

Deploy Seismographs In Misty Meadows Or Catty Corner (3)

Accept Dialogue: We’re detecting tremors where everything should be stable.

Guide: Misty Meadows seismographs can be found by the massive fountain, under the clock tower and by the Bounty Board near the lake. Catty Corner seismographs can be found by the junkyard bounty board, near the gas station and behind the garage.

Complete Dialogue: It’s not a class V split, but it’s definitively something.

Reward: 12,000 XP and 20 Bars

Exterminate Mini-Puffs With A Pickaxe In Sludgy Swamp, Lazy Lake Or Retail Row (3)

Accept Dialogue: Don’t be fooled by their cuddly appearance. Those Pufts are destructive.

Guide: There are 3 in each POI.

Complete Dialogue: Who wants toasted evil marshmallows?

Reward: 14,000 XP and 25 Bars

Retrieve Mechanical Parts By Destroying Cars (5)

Accept Dialogue: A silver-tipped harpoon could work as a wolf deterrent!

Guide: After destroying a car, truck or bus, massive mechanical pieces will be left over which you can pick up.

Complete Dialogue: This may seem reckless, but hey, science is reckless!

Reward: 16,000 XP and 30 Bars

Place Ghostbusters Signs In Holly Hedges, Dirty Docks Or Pleasant Park (3)

Accept Dialogue: The Ghostbusters will be back! Maybe these signs will scare off the ghosts.

Guide: Though the quest doesn’t mention it, you can place these in Craggy Cliffs.

Complete Dialogue: A wise man once said, “I ain’t afraid of no ghost”.

Reward: 18,000 XP and 40 Bars

Deploy A Ghost Trap (1)

Accept Dialogue: Finally, the ghost traps are ready. It’s time to put them to good use.

Guide: Ghost traps can be deployed in every POI except for Coral Castle, Sludgy Swamp and Steamy Stacks.

Complete Dialogue: Now you’re a ghostbuster!

Reward: 20,000 XP and 70 Bars

Fortnite: Battle Royale – Wolf Activity Questline Guide

Chapter 2, Season 8 of Fortnite introduced questlines into Battle Royale, a feature that was in Save The World ever since its release. One of the questlines, Wolf Activity, is all about interacting with and hunting wolves, presented to us by none other than Grim Fable, one of the characters from Chapter 1, Season 6.

The Quests

Hide In A Haystack At Corny Crops (5)

Accept Dialogue: There’s rumblings of wolf activity in the area. Check it out.

Guide: Since Corny Crops is a farm, haystacks are pretty much everywhere.

Complete Dialogue: Ahh! They’re headed towards the houses!

Reward: 12,000 XP and 20 Bars

Destroy Beds In Holly Hedges Or Pleasant Park (3)

Accept Dialogue: The wolves must be going for the granny-in-bed ploy!

Guide: Holly and Pleasant are both residential areas, so beds can be found in practically every house.

Complete Dialogue: Thanks for that! Now the wolves can’t pull that one again.

Reward: 14,000 XP and 25 Bars

Collect A Harpoon Gun (2)

Accept Dialogue: A silver-tipped harpoon could work as a wolf deterrent!

Guide: This can easily be done in Craggy Cliffs due to the high quantity of fishing barrels there.

Complete Dialogue: Right, I think we’re ready to strike back.

Reward: 16,000 XP and 30 Bars

Hunt A Wolf (4)

Accept Dialogue: Strike down that scoundrel of a wolf!

Guide: Wolves are commonly found in grasslands and the jungle in Stealthy Stronghold, alongside Lake Canoe.

Complete Dialogue: That was a thing of beauty!

Reward: 18,000 XP and 40 Bars

Emote Within 10m Of Wildlife (1)

Accept Dialogue: Celebrate with the local wildlife! It helps if you tame them first.

Guide: Wildlife can be easily found in Stealthy Stronghold, where there are frogs and boars casually roaming around, and sometimes raptors too.

Complete Dialogue: I’m sure deep down the wildlife understood our joy.

Reward: 20,000 XP and 70 Bars

Fortnite: Battle Royale – Monster Research Questline Guide

Chapter 2, Season 8 of Fortnite introduced questlines into Battle Royale, a feature that was in Save The World ever since its release. One of the questlines, Monster Research, is all about experimenting with the Sideways feature that was added this season, with all 5 of the quests offered by Torin, the new Battle Pass character.

The Quests

Enter The Sideways (1)

Accept Dialogue: You think you can handle the Sideways? Prove it.

Guide: The Sideways is a new feature that is randomly generated every match. At the start, a massive bubble will be visible on the Island, which is the gateway to the Sideways dimension. Simply enter it to complete the quest.

Complete Dialogue: Call yourself a hunter if you want, but we’re the ones being hunted.

Reward: 12,000 XP and 20 Bars

Collect A Sideways Weapon (1)

Accept Dialogue: The weapons in there? They’re powerful. I’d grab one, if you can.

Guide: Sideways weapons can be found in chests inside Sideways zones.

Complete Dialogue: Don’t point that thing at me.

Reward: 14,000 XP and 25 Bars

Damage Players With A Sideways Weapon (100)

Accept Dialogue: Sideways weapons have a real kick to ’em. Get used to it.

Guide: While there are AI enemies inside the Sideways, the quest is asking you to deal player damage specifically.

Complete Dialogue: … Maybe you’ll be useful in this hunt after all.

Reward: 16,000 XP and 30 Bars

Eliminate Cube Monsters In The Sideways (10)

Accept Dialogue: This is it. It’s time to prove yourself as a hunter.

Guide: Cube Monsters similar to the ones from Chapter 1, Season 6 pop up in the Sideways, so all you have to do is eliminate 10 of them.

Complete Dialogue: Huh. You survived. Good work.

Reward: 18,000 XP and 40 Bars

Complete A Sideways Encounter (1)

Accept Dialogue: If you can manage a full hunt, I’ll be really impressed.

Guide: Sideways zones can be encountered via purple rifts marked on the map. Completing a full Sideways encounter requires you to eliminate a lot of Cube Monsters, so have a lot of loot with you!

Complete Dialogue: Fine. If you don’t ask any personal questions… you can join my hunt.

Reward: 20,000 XP and 70 Bars
